    They're small but chunky board books—and they're guaranteed to fascinate toddlers with their moving animal illustrations that present charming visual surprises. Each two-page spread has a "who's there?" question and a peephole showing a pair of animal eyes. Kids place a finger into a slot cut into each illustration, give a little push, and out pops the complete animal. There are six pop-out surprises in every book, and the brightly colored cartoon-style animals who come popping out will delight little boys and girls. A baby chick breaks out from his egg when kids put a finger in the cover's slot. They'll find five more slide-out surprises on the pages that follow. (Ages 1-4)

    When Emma has recurring nightmares about being sent to the first of three children's homes, her twin sister suggests the bad dreams may stop if Emma writes down all her memories. The result is an account of the trials and triumphs of Emma and Emily from ages six to fifteen. Follow along from 1924-1933 as the girls cope with their parents' arguments and eventual divorce. See how they survive life in the children's homes and the hardships of the Great Depression. Keep hope with them as they yearn for a brighter future. Have fun with the twins as they uncover a big mystery, enjoy visits with their parents, and meet their first loves. Learn how Emma influences her twin sister after she makes a life-changing decision in Sunday school, and discover if the twins beat the odds and are able to forgive.
